David A. Lewis is a recording artist, prolific composer/arranger, writer, music director, choral director, and music educator. He has been commissioned numerous times to write original music for theatre, radio, and video. His commissioned theatre works include original music and lyrics for C.S. Lewis' "The Lion, the Witch, and the Wardrobe", Charles Dickens' "A Christmas Carol (Scrooge)," Tim Kelley's melodrama "No Opera at the Op'ry House Tonight," and Anne Relph's play, "All Aboard Westcliffe". David is also the creator (book, music, and lyrics) of the family musical "The Lost Children" (a.k.a. "A Magical Journey"), which debuted to audiences in 1994 and continues to run in theatres. In addition to serving as musical director for these original shows, David has also been the music director for many other musical productions including "Oklahoma," "Grease," and "Facets of Broadway." David also was commissioned to write the music for the "SkyPark" infomercial.

In response to the tragic events of September 11, 2001 David penned the emotionally charged patriotic pop song "America! America!" which was performed by Cypress "Pops" Orchestra for over 3,000 people in which David received a standing ovation. "America! America!" has also been used by DisneyGOALS, radio stations KFI and KUCI, the city of Irvine's "Light of Unity" candlelight vigil program, and for numerous other community events. On February 11, 2003 a special performance of "America! America!" was televised on local cable television.

David's solo piano CD of original music called, "Coming of Age" was released in November of 2002 and is currently available for purchase at selected stores and through his website "trailblazermusic.com". David performs for various venues, numerous charitable events, and will be performing at the Nixon Library in the Fall of 2003. David's next CD, "From the Beginning" will be available in January of 2004.

David taught piano at Golden West Community College, CA for nine years and currently operates his own piano and recording studio. He has been the church choir director and pianist for Fairview Community Church in Costa Mesa, CA for the last nine years. David is a Piano Performance Scholarship winner from the University California, Irvine where he holds degrees in both Piano Performance and Political Science and he is currently pursing a degree in film scoring at UCLA. David presently lives in North Tustin, CA with his wife, Laura and their two cats, Sophie & Turbo.
